    Abstract: The present technology relates to a reception device, reception method, and program that can prevent erroneous detection of a predetermined signal, such as a P1 signal, included in, for example, a received signal such as DVB-T2. A correlation calculation unit obtains a correlation value between received signals including a predetermined signal in which an original signal and a duplicate signal obtained from a copy of at least a part of the original signal are disposed. An average power calculation unit obtains average power of the received signals. A normalization unit obtains a normalized correlation value obtained by normalizing the correlation value by the average power. The present technology can be applied to a case where a P1 signal being a preamble signal is detected from a received signal such as DVB-T2, for example.

    Abstract: The invention relates to use of a catalyst comprising particles of nickel dispersed in a porous silica matrix for catalysing a methanation reaction. There is also described a method for methanation of a feedstock at least comprising gases carbon monoxide and hydrogen, said method comprising contacting the feedstock with the catalyst.

    Abstract: The present technique relates to a channel scan device and method, and a program configured so that high-speed channel scan is enabled. The power spectrum extracting unit 31 of the decoding unit 22 extracts a power level for each frequency of an input signal as a power spectrum, and supplies the power level to the channel scan processing unit 23. The channel scan processing unit 23 extracts a trapezoidal band, which constitutes a power spectrum waveform, in a power spectrum as a channel candidate, and extracts a channel, for which synchronization of a clock and synchronization of a TS required for reproduction of audio and video can be confirmed, as a valid channel. The present technique can be applied to a television receiver.

    Abstract: The present technique relates to a demodulation device, a demodulation method and a program capable of realizing a demodulation process at a rate equivalent to a case where I and Q channel signals are not inverted, even when the I and Q channel signals are inverted. A frequency correction unit establishes synchronization of a frequency and clock based on a signal from a frequency synchronization unit. A channel inversion detection unit of a frame synchronization unit detects presence or absence of inversion of I and Q channel signals, and supplies, as a detection result, a channel inversion detection result to the channel inversion control unit. The channel inversion control unit switches the I and Q channel signals if the inversion has occurred, based on the channel inversion detection result. This technique can be applied to a demodulation device.

    Abstract: Front and rear side flange portions of a filter accommodating cylinder are provided with positioning pins. A flange portion of an upstream cylinder is provided with a notched groove and a flange portion of a downstream cylinder is provided with a notched groove. In consequence, when the filter accommodating cylinder is connected between the upstream cylinder and the downstream cylinder, each of the positioning pins disposed at the front and rear flange portions is engaged with each notched groove of the upstream cylinder and the downstream cylinder. The filter accommodating cylinder can be positioned to be coaxial with the upstream cylinder and the downstream cylinder. As a result, after performing a cleaning operation to a DPF, an operation of once again connecting the filter accommodating cylinder between the upstream cylinder and the downstream cylinder can be quickly and easily performed.

    Abstract: Provided is a manufacturing device of an aluminum nitride single crystal including a crucible. An aluminum nitride raw material and a seed crystal are stored in an inner portion of the crucible. The seed crystal is placed so as to face the aluminum nitride raw material. The crucible includes an inner crucible and an outer crucible. The inner crucible stores the aluminum nitride raw material and the seed crystal inside the inner crucible. The inner crucible is also corrosion resistant to a sublimation gas of the aluminum nitride raw material. The inner crucible includes either, a single body of a metal having an ion radius larger than an ion radius of an aluminum, or includes a nitride of the metal. The outer crucible includes a boron nitride. The outer crucible covers the inner crucible.

    Abstract: An engine (8) is mounted to a vehicle body by means of vibration isolating mounts (8E), and a support member (15) is mounted to the engine (8). Vibration isolating members (20) are provided between this support member (15) and a mounting bracket (17) mounted to an exhaust gas treatment device (16). Accordingly, even in cases where the engine (8) has generated high-frequency vibrations, these vibrations can be damped by the vibration isolating mounts (8E) and the vibration isolating members (20). In consequence, treatment members constituting the exhaust gas treatment device (16), such as a catalyst, a filter, and a sensor, can be protected from the vibrations of the engine (8). In addition, as the exhaust gas treatment device (16) is provided with the mounting bracket (17), the vibration isolating members (20) can be reliably mounted to the exhaust gas treatment device (16) by means of the mounting bracket (17).
